Athens

Days 1 - 4

Dominating the Attica region of Greece, the country’s capital, Athens, is one of the oldest cities in the world. For over two and a half centuries, the astonishing Greek temples and monuments of Athens have continued to intrigue and amaze visitors from around the world. This icon of western civilization seamlessly combines ancient history with modern architecture and a surprisingly lively atmosphere. This is particularly apparent in areas at the foot of the Acropolis, Anafiotika, Plaka, Monastiraki, and Thissio where visitors will find numerous extraordinary Neoclassical buildings, trendy and traditional cafes, and shops, and narrow winding streets with historical treasures at every turn. Once you have enjoyed a history and art fix, try some mouth-watering Greek cuisine at one of the city’s fine local restaurants before indulging in the insatiable nightlife at the chic cocktail bars and waterfront dance clubs.

Mykonos

Days 4 - 7

Out of all of the Cyclades - the group of islands that surround the sacred Greek island of Delos - Mykonos is perhaps the most famous. It is known for its gorgeous green rolling hills, exquisite beaches and the glamorous, cosmopolitan crowd that typically vacations here. While Mykonos makes for an ideal base for archaeological day trips to the nearby islands, the island itself has plenty to offer. Spend your days exploring the quaint winding alleyways strewn with iconic whitewashed houses; sailing around the picturesque harbour and out into the glistening Aegean Sea; unwinding on the idyllic beaches, and dining in the numerous fine restaurants. If it’s unforgettable nightlife, a bit of luxury, and plenty of natural beauty you are after, Mykonos is undoubtedly the destination for you.

Naousa

Days 7 - 9

Naoussa is a beautiful, authentic-feeling fishing village set on the north side of Paros, Greece, 10 kilometres east of Parikia (the capital city). A 15th-century Venetian Fortress watches over the port, where it once defended the city against pirate invasions. The Piperi town beach provides the perfect place to take a dip in the crystal clear waters, for which the town is famous, along with its true-to-culture atmosphere and brightly coloured sea-facing bars and restaurants. Take a full-day sailing cruise, enjoy the freshest, most traditional seafood dishes, and explore the winding cobbled alleyways up the hill.

Santorini

Days 9 - 12

Classically known as Thera and officially Thira, the picturesque island of Santorini dots the South Aegean Sea. Some destinations have stunning beaches and breathtaking natural landscapes, while others have extraordinary ancient cities and excellent restaurants. The popular Greek island of Santorini is blessed with all of these attractive features and more. This lovely volcanic island in the Cyclades lies in the middle of the Aegean and is well known for its strikingly white cliff-side homes with their pretty deep blue rooftops. Visitors will be treated to dramatic ocean views, pristine beaches, traditional Grecian architecture, many fascinating historical sites, fine dining, and excellent local wineries. With all of this on offer, it is little wonder that this remarkably romantic island has become one of the world’s most popular island getaways.
